Description

Face value: 500 tenge.

Date of issue: 13 October, 2007.

Averse: State Emblem of Kazakhstan is depicted against ornamental background; face value of the coin “500 TENGE”; two legends in Kazakh and in Russian “REPUBLIC OF KAZAKHSTAN”.

Reverse: image of custom episode “Tusau kesu” (Cutting hobbles) render, the custom connected with the first steps of child; name of the coin in Kazakh “TUSAU KESU”;  “2007” means the year of coinage; “Ag 925 31,1gr.” means metal, standard of coinage and weight; trade mark of Kazakhstan Mint.

Lateral surface is grooved.

Weight: 31,1 gr.

Diameter: 38,61 mm.

Fineness: 925 Ag.

Quality: proof.

Mintage: 4 000.
